At present, the portal frame structure with light steel has been widely used with less consumption of steel, faster construction speed and better benefit economy with comparison to the traditional one. Frequently, every element of portal frame structures with light steel may be jointed with others out of its plane as a three-dimension bearing system in the actual structures. But now, analysis of portal frame structures mainly adopts the plane frame model, therefore it is impossible to involve the space characteristics of structures. Thus, with the aim of making the design and application of this structure to be scientific and economical, the space work of portal frame structures with light steel is analyze (?) under vertical loads and horizontal loads, and the select of the members that influenced the space work of the structures are also performed in this paper.In this paper, the finite element software SAP2000 is selected for ewuivalent three dimensional analysis of the gumnasium structure in order to analyze the space work of portal frame structure with light steel when under vertical load. Meanwhile, the scene static test is carried out to explore the static capacity of the gumnasium structure under vertical load. At last, the space work of portal frame structure with light steel under vertical load is preliminarily researched by compared with results of the static test and SAP2000 calculation. As the SAP2000 three-dimension model calculation corresponds well with static test results, the space work should be considered when the portal frame structures with light steel are under vertical load. Thus, the finite element softeware calculation contrasted with test results can be referred as practical approaches for portal frame structure and other structures.The equivalent three dimensional analysis of one-stpry manufacturing house under horizontal loads is also carried out to explore the space work of portal frame structure with light steel. And the influence of longitudinal connecting bars on the space work is analyzed in this paper. Then the optimization design about longitudinal bars connecting is worked out and lay a solid foundation for further rescarch work.
